How To Fix R7746 - Error when saving the active version of InfoCube &1


R7746 - Overview

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: R7 - BW: Data basis

  • Message number: 746

  • Message text: Error when saving the active version of InfoCube &1

    The SAP error message R7746, which states "Error when saving the active version of InfoCube &1," typically occurs during the process of saving changes to an InfoCube in SAP BW (Business Warehouse). This error can arise due to various reasons, and understanding the cause is essential for finding a solution.
    Possible Causes:
    
    Data Model Issues: There may be inconsistencies or errors in the data model of the InfoCube, such as incorrect relationships or missing objects.
    Transport Issues: If the InfoCube is part of a transport request, there may be issues with the transport itself, such as missing objects or dependencies.
    Authorization Problems: The user may not have the necessary authorizations to save changes to the InfoCube.
    Database Issues: There could be underlying database issues, such as locks or constraints that prevent the saving of the InfoCube.
    Technical Errors: There may be technical errors in the system, such as memory issues or system configuration problems.
